Skip to content
Technologie & IngenieurwesenJunior

Lebenslauf-Beispiel Junior

Professionelles Lebenslauf-Beispiel Junior. ATS-optimierte Vorlage.

Junior Gehaltsspanne (US)

$65,000 - $95,000

Warum dieser Lebenslauf funktioniert

Starke Verben beginnen jeden Punkt

Entwickelt, Implementiert, Aufgebaut, Bereitgestellt. Jeder Punkt beginnt mit einem Aktionsverb, das beweist, dass du die Arbeit vorangetrieben hast - nicht nur zugeschaut.

Zahlen machen den Einfluss unbestreitbar

8K täglich aktive Nutzer, von 1,2s auf 280ms, 3 nachgelagerte Dienste. Recruiter merken sich Zahlen. Ohne sie sind deine Punkte nur Meinungen.

Kontext und Ergebnisse in jedem Punkt

Nicht 'Express verwendet', sondern 'mit rollenbasierter Zugriffskontrolle'. Nicht 'API gebaut', sondern 'zur gleichzeitigen Webhook-Auslieferung'. Der Kontext ist der eigentliche Punkt.

Zusammenarbeit zeigt sich auch auf Junior-Ebene

Frontend-Team, Produkt-Stakeholder, Code-Reviews. Zeige auch als Junior, dass du MIT Menschen arbeitest und nicht isoliert.

Tech-Stack im Kontext platziert, nicht aufgelistet

'Express und PostgreSQL mit Prisma ORM', nicht 'Express, PostgreSQL, Prisma'. Technologien erscheinen innerhalb von Leistungen und beweisen, dass du sie tatsächlich eingesetzt hast.

Wesentliche Fähigkeiten

  • Node.js
  • JavaScript
  • Express
  • REST-APIs
  • PostgreSQL oder MongoDB
  • Git
  • TypeScript
  • Redis
  • Docker
  • Jest
  • Prisma oder Sequelize

Verbessern Sie Ihren Lebenslauf

Node.js hat die Art und Weise, wie Entwickler skalierbare Backend-Systeme aufbauen, grundlegend verändert, und dein Lebenslauf muss beweisen, dass du sowohl die Laufzeitumgebung als auch das Ökosystem verstehst. Recruiter suchen nach Belegen für die Beherrschung der asynchronen Programmierung, praktische Erfahrung mit Express oder NestJS, Datenbankintegration und Deployment-Kompetenz. Allgemeine Aussagen wie 'eine REST-API gebaut' bedeuten ohne Metriken, architektonischen Kontext und den Nachweis, dass dein Code in der Produktion lief, gar nichts. Dieser Leitfaden zeigt dir, wie Node.js-Profis auf allen Erfahrungsstufen Lebensläufe schreiben, die Türen öffnen, von Junior-Entwicklern, die ihre erste Backend-Stelle antreten, bis hin zu Principal Engineers, die Plattformen für Millionen von Nutzern entwerfen.

Best Practices für den Lebenslauf als Junior Node.js Developer

  1. Beginne jeden Stichpunkt mit Aktionsverben, die Eigenverantwortung zeigen. 'RESTful-API-Schicht gebaut' statt 'an API-Projekt mitgearbeitet'. Verben wie 'Entwickelt', 'Implementiert', 'Erstellt', 'Aufgebaut' beweisen, dass du die Arbeit vorangetrieben hast.

  2. Füge in jeder Leistungsaussage konkrete Metriken ein. 'Bedient 8.000 täglich aktive Nutzer' oder 'Deployment-Schritte von 12 auf 1 reduziert' geben Recruitern Zahlen, die sie sich merken können. Vage Aussagen ohne Metriken werden ignoriert.

  3. Bette den Tech-Stack in Erfolge ein, nicht als separate Liste. 'TypeScript und Express mit Prisma ORM' innerhalb eines Stichpunkts über Datenbankmigrationen beweist, dass du die Tools eingesetzt hast. 'Node.js, Express, PostgreSQL' in einem Skills-Abschnitt zu listen beweist gar nichts.

  4. Zeige Teamarbeit auch auf Junior-Ebene. 'In Zusammenarbeit mit dem Frontend-Team API-Schnittstellen definiert' und 'an wöchentlichen Code-Reviews teilgenommen' zeigen, dass du mit anderen zusammenarbeitest und kein Einzelkämpfer bist.

  5. Begründe jede technische Entscheidung mit Kontext. Nicht 'Webhook-System gebaut', sondern 'gleichzeitige Webhook-Zustellungen mit automatischer Wiederholungslogik verwaltet'. Kontext unterscheidet Juniors, die liefern, von Juniors, die nur ausprobieren.

Häufige Fehler im Lebenslauf als Junior Node.js Developer

  1. Technologien auflisten, ohne zu beweisen, dass du sie eingesetzt hast. 'Skills: Node.js, Express, PostgreSQL' sagt Recruitern nichts. Bette Tools stattdessen in Leistungsaussagen ein: 'RESTful-API mit Express und PostgreSQL gebaut, die 8.000 tägliche Anfragen verarbeitet'.

  2. Stichpunkte ohne Metriken oder Ergebnisse. 'Backend-Features entwickelt' ist wertlos ohne Zahlen. 'Webhook-Zustellsystem mit gleichzeitiger Verarbeitung und automatischer Wiederholungslogik gebaut' zeigt, was du wirklich getan hast.

  3. Passivkonstruktionen oder schwache Verben verwenden. 'War verantwortlich für API-Entwicklung' klingt, als hättest du jemand anderen beobachtet. 'RESTful-API-Schicht für 8.000 Nutzer gebaut' beweist, dass du die Arbeit vorangetrieben hast.

  4. Keine Teamarbeitssignale. Juniors, die 'in Zusammenarbeit mit dem Frontend-Team' und 'Teilnahme an Code-Reviews' zeigen, signalisieren gute Teamfähigkeit. Juniors, die nur Solo-Projekte auflisten, signalisieren Isolationsrisiko.

  5. Kein Kontext für technische Entscheidungen. 'API gebaut' sagt Recruitern nichts. 'API mit rollenbasierter Zugriffskontrolle für Nutzer- und Admin-Endpunkte gebaut' beweist, dass du Produktionsanforderungen verstehst, nicht nur Tutorials.

Tipps für den Lebenslauf als Junior Node.js Developer

  1. Führe mit deinem stärksten technischen Projekt, nicht mit deiner Ausbildung. Wenn du eine Echtzeit-Aufgabenverwaltungs-API mit Socket.IO und Redis gebaut hast, wollen Recruiter das zuerst sehen. Ausbildung kann nach Erfahrungen und Projekten kommen.

  2. Quantifiziere alles, was möglich ist. '8.000 täglich aktive Nutzer', 'Deployment von 12 Schritten auf 1 reduziert', '3 nachgelagerte Services'. Zahlen machen deine Arbeit einprägsam. Ohne sie verschmelzen deine Stichpunkte mit jedem anderen Junior-Lebenslauf.

  3. Zeige, dass du Produktionsanforderungen verstehst, nicht nur Tutorials. 'Mit rollenbasierter Zugriffskontrolle' und 'mit automatischer Wiederholungslogik und Dead-Letter-Queues' beweisen, dass du über Fehlerbehandlung, Sicherheit und Zuverlässigkeit nachdenkst.

  4. Binde in jeder Position Teamarbeitssignale ein. 'In Zusammenarbeit mit dem Frontend-Team' und 'Teilnahme an Code-Reviews' zeigen, dass du gut mit anderen zusammenarbeitest. Solo-Projektlisten signalisieren potenzielles Teamfit-Risiko.

  5. Nutze GitHub-Links strategisch. Verlinke auf deine besten 2-3 Projekte mit sauberen READMEs, nicht auf jedes Repository. Qualität vor Quantität. Ein gepflegtes Projekt mit Dokumentation schlägt 20 halbfertige Repos.

Häufig gestellte Fragen

Starke Node.js-Lebensläufe belegen die Beherrschung der asynchronen Programmierung durch echte Produktionsbeispiele mit Metriken. Zeige Backend-Systeme, die du gebaut hast (APIs, Microservices, event-gesteuerte Plattformen), quantifiziere die Skalierung (Anfragen pro Sekunde, gleichzeitige Verbindungen, Latenzverbesserungen) und bette deinen Tech-Stack in den Kontext ein (Express mit Rate Limiting, Kafka für Event-Verarbeitung). Leadership-Signale (Mentoring, teamübergreifende Arbeit, architektonische Entscheidungen) trennen Mid-Level und Senior-Level voneinander.

Nein. Liste nur Frameworks und wichtige Bibliotheken auf (Express, NestJS, Fastify, Prisma, Sequelize), eingebettet in Leistungsaussagen, die zeigen, wie du sie eingesetzt hast. 'API mit Express und Prisma ORM für Datenbankmigrationen gebaut' beweist die Verwendung. 50 npm-Pakete in einem Skills-Abschnitt aufzulisten beweist nichts und lässt deinen Lebenslauf überladen wirken.

Entscheidend für Mid-Level und höher. Die meisten modernen Node.js-Unternehmen verwenden TypeScript für Typsicherheit, bessere Tooling-Unterstützung und Wartbarkeit. Junior-Stellen akzeptieren möglicherweise auch reine JavaScript-Kandidaten, aber TypeScript-Kompetenz erweitert deine Möglichkeiten erheblich. Zeige TypeScript in Produktionsprojekten, nicht nur in Nebenprojekten oder Kursen.

Express (Industriestandard, einfach, weit verbreitet), NestJS (enterprise-grade, TypeScript-first, wächst schnell), Fastify (hohe Performance, Plugin-Ökosystem). Zeige, welche du in der Produktion eingesetzt hast. Koa oder Hapi zu erwähnen ist in Ordnung, wenn du sie genutzt hast, aber Express und NestJS dominieren die Einstellungsnachfrage. Bette Framework-Namen in Leistungsaussagen ein: 'Microservices mit NestJS und eigenen Decorators gebaut'.

Das ist für Junior-Level völlig in Ordnung. Behandle Bootcamp-Abschlussprojekte wie echte Arbeit: Quantifiziere Nutzer, beschreibe die Architektur, zeige das Deployment. Praktika zählen als Erfahrung, liste sie im Erfahrungsabschnitt auf, nicht in der Ausbildung. Wenn dein Bootcamp-Projekt echten Nutzern gedient hat (selbst 100), ist das besser als ein Tutorial-Klon ohne Nutzung.

Empfohlene Zertifizierungen

Vorbereitung auf Vorstellungsgespräche

Node.js-Vorstellungsgespräche testen die Grundlagen der asynchronen Programmierung, Backend-Architekturmuster und Produktionsreife. Erwarte Live-Coding-Aufgaben zu Promises, async/await, Event-Emittern und Streams. System-Design-Runden konzentrieren sich auf API-Design, Datenbankauswahl, Caching-Strategien und Skalierungsmuster. Verhaltensfragen beleuchten Zusammenarbeit, das Debuggen von Produktionsvorfällen und technische Entscheidungsfindung. Senior- und Principal-Kandidaten sehen sich vertieften Architektur-Diskussionen über Microservices, event-gesteuerte Systeme und Plattformdesign gegenüber.

Häufige Fragen

Häufige Interviewfragen für Junior Node.js Developer

  1. Erkläre den Event Loop und wie Node.js asynchrone Operationen verarbeitet. Demonstriere das Verständnis von Call Stack, Callback-Queue und Event Loop. Zeige, dass du weißt, warum Node.js nicht-blockierend ist.

  2. Was ist der Unterschied zwischen Callback, Promise und async/await? Gehe durch Beispiele, die Fehlerbehandlung in jedem Muster zeigen. Erkläre, warum async/await in modernem Code bevorzugt wird.

  3. Wie verbindest du dich mit einer Datenbank in Node.js? Zeige echten Code mit Prisma oder Sequelize ORM. Diskutiere Connection Pooling und warum es für die Performance relevant ist.

  4. Baue eine einfache REST-API mit Express. Codiere live einen POST- und GET-Endpunkt mit Validierung, Fehlerbehandlung und einem Datenbankaufruf. Beweise, dass du funktionierenden Backend-Code liefern kannst.

  5. Wie gehst du mit Fehlern in asynchronem Code um? Zeige try/catch mit async/await und .catch() mit Promises. Diskutiere zentralisiertes Error-Handling-Middleware in Express.

Brancheneinsatz

Wie sich Ihre Fähigkeiten in verschiedenen Branchen einsetzen lassen

Tech/SaaS

Aufbau skalierbarer APIs, Microservices und Backend-Infrastruktur für Web-Anwendungen und Cloud-Plattformen

REST-APIsGraphQLMicroservicesCloud-Infrastruktur

Fintech

Zahlungsabwicklung, Transaktionssysteme, Echtzeit-Abwicklung und hochzuverlässige Backend-Services mit strengen Compliance-Anforderungen

ZahlungsabwicklungPCI-ComplianceTransaktionsintegritätEchtzeit-Vergleich

E-Commerce

Bestellverarbeitungs-Pipelines, Bestandsverwaltung, Empfehlungssysteme und High-Traffic-Checkout-Flows

Auftragsbearbeitunginventory systemsCheckout-APIsProduktkataloge

Medien/Streaming

Content-Delivery, Echtzeit-Streaming-Backends, Nutzer-Engagement-Tracking und Content-Metadatenverwaltung im großen Maßstab

Content DeliveryStreaming-BackendsCDN-IntegrationMetadaten-Verwaltung

Gaming

Game-Server-Backends, Matchmaking-Systeme, Echtzeit-Bestenlisten, In-Game-Wirtschaft und Spielerdaten-Persistenz

game serversMatchmakingBestenlistenWebSocket-Verbindungen

Gehaltsanalyse

VERHANDLUNGSSTRATEGIE

Verhandlungstipps

Node.js-Entwickler haben starke Verhandlungsposition in Märkten mit hoher Backend-Nachfrage. Hebe Produktionsskalierungsmetriken hervor (Anfragen pro Sekunde, gleichzeitige Nutzer, System-Uptime) und Backend-Spezialisierung (Microservices, event-gesteuerte Architektur, Kubernetes). Senior+-Kandidaten sollten Team-Führung, Plattformverantwortung und organisatorischen Impact betonen. Verhandle auf Basis der Gesamtvergütung einschließlich Eigenkapital, Remote-Flexibilität und Lernbudgets für AWS/GCP-Zertifizierungen oder Konferenzteilnahmen.

Wichtige Faktoren

Das Gehalt variiert erheblich nach Standort (SF/NYC/Seattle 20-40% höher als mittelgroße Städte), Unternehmensphase (FAANG/Einhörner zahlen 30-50% über dem Durchschnitt) und Spezialisierungstiefe (Microservices-Architektur, Platform Engineering, Echtzeit-Systeme erzielen Prämien). Remote-Stellen zahlen oft 10-20% unter den Top-Marktpreisen, bieten aber Flexibilität im Lebensstil. TypeScript-Kompetenz, Cloud-Plattform-Expertise (AWS/GCP/Azure) und Kubernetes-Erfahrung erhöhen das Grundgehalt auf Mid-Senior-Ebene um 15-25%.